GSK189075 + norgestrel + ethinylestradiol is a combination investigational drug. **Norgestrel** is a synthetic progestin, and **ethinylestradiol** is a synthetic estrogen; both are widely used in oral contraceptives to inhibit ovulation and produce changes to cervical mucus and the endometrium, resulting in contraceptive effects[1][2][4]. **GSK189075** is a GlaxoSmithKline developmental candidate, but public sources contain limited information on its mechanism, role, or stage of development in combination with these established contraceptive agents. The combination likely aims to provide contraception, with possible added novel benefit or feature contributed by GSK189075.
